我的问题域有一个Store
模型。有什么方法可以保留App.Store
并使其他类扩展DS.Store
?我看到一些关于register('store:main')
的代码,但我不知道我可以干净地覆盖它。
如果有必要,我可以重命名Store
,我只是希望保留与现有后端相同的名称。
答案 0 :(得分:1)
我想你不能,因为Store
是ember-data
的保留类名。此外,当您执行App.Store = DS.Store.extend()
应用程序命名空间Store
上的属性App
时,ember-data
会查找名称为Store
的{{1}},如果它不存在它不起作用。如果您只是将商店模型重命名为其他内容以避免名称冲突,则可以更好地服务IMO。
希望有所帮助